Fig. 4: The structure of the TkoTpt1/DNA/Appr > P complex-A.
From: Crystal structures and snapshots along Tpt1-catalyzed phosphate transfer from nucleic acid to NAD+

a Overall folding of the TkoTpt1/DNA/Appr>P complex-A. The bound DNA and Appr>P molecules are shown as sticks with their C-atoms colored in pink and cyan, respectively. b 2Fo-Fc electron density maps of the bound DNA and Appr>P molecules. c The detailed interactions between TkoTpt1 and the cyclic PO4 and ribose of Appr>P. d Superposition showing the conformational changes prior to and after the formation of the Appr>P product. Protein residues, DNA, and Appr>P in TkoTpt1/DNA/Appr>P complex-A are colored as in (c). For the TkoTpt1/DNA/NAD+ complex, the C-atoms of protein residues, DNA, and NAD+ are colored in gray and the sulfur atom of the bound SO42− is colored in green.
